Transaction e778dee8b374511d97c2fbee2ffc474bf562843724ba93cf5a6c564950c30975
1 Input
1 Output
-
e778dee8b374511d97c2fbee2ffc474bf562843724ba93cf5a6c564950c30975:0
- value
- 19730152
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ff7184eec0031c90b146cd6d4e7006746d130aa OP_EQUAL
- address
- MM2NsKXtNhWxuedZqFgnC1VvfzyexBCKLY